DukeAnn
做一个优雅的程序员

Git单独checkout(拉取)子目录

在现有的仓库目录下执行以下命令

  1. Enable sparse-checkout:
    git config core.sparsecheckout true
  2. Configure sparse-checkout by listing your desired sub-trees in .git/info/sparse-checkout:
    echo some/dir/ >> .git/info/sparse-checkout
    echo another/sub/tree >> .git/info/sparse-checkout
  3. Update your working tree:
    git read-tree -mu HEAD
DukeAnn的笔记本:DukeAnn的博客 » Git单独checkout(拉取)子目录
分享到: 更多 (0)

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址